怎么把文件夹名称转为excel列表

怎么把文件夹名称转为excel列表

要把文件夹名称转为Excel列表,可以通过以下几种方法:使用文件管理软件、编写脚本、手动复制粘贴。其中,通过编写Python脚本是最为高效和灵活的方法。下面将详细介绍Python脚本的方法。

一、使用Python脚本将文件夹名称转为Excel列表

Python是一种强大且易学的编程语言,利用Python,我们可以轻松地读取文件夹名称并将其写入Excel文件中。这里主要用到的Python库包括ospandasopenpyxl

1. 安装所需Python库

在使用这些库之前,我们需要先进行安装。可以使用以下命令:

pip install pandas openpyxl

2. 编写Python脚本

下面是一个简单的Python脚本示例,它可以读取指定目录下的所有文件夹名称,并将其写入一个Excel文件中:

import os

import pandas as pd

def get_folder_names(directory):

folder_names = []

for root, dirs, files in os.walk(directory):

for dir in dirs:

folder_names.append(dir)

return folder_names

def save_to_excel(folder_names, output_file):

df = pd.DataFrame(folder_names, columns=['Folder Name'])

df.to_excel(output_file, index=False)

if __name__ == "__main__":

directory = input("Enter the directory path: ")

output_file = input("Enter the output Excel file path: ")

folder_names = get_folder_names(directory)

save_to_excel(folder_names, output_file)

print(f"Folder names have been saved to {output_file}")

3. 运行脚本

将上述脚本保存为一个Python文件(例如folder_to_excel.py),然后在命令行中运行它:

python folder_to_excel.py

按照提示输入目录路径和输出Excel文件路径,脚本将会读取该目录下的所有文件夹名称,并将其保存到指定的Excel文件中。

二、使用文件管理软件

除了编写脚本之外,还可以使用一些文件管理软件来实现这一功能。例如,Total Commander、Directory List & Print等。这些软件通常具有导出文件和文件夹列表的功能,可以直接将结果保存为Excel文件或CSV文件。

1. Total Commander

Total Commander是一款功能强大的文件管理工具,它可以方便地列出指定目录下的所有文件和文件夹,并将其导出为多种格式,包括Excel格式。

步骤:

  1. 打开Total Commander并导航到目标目录。
  2. 选择“文件”菜单中的“打印”选项,或者按快捷键Ctrl+P
  3. 在弹出的对话框中选择“保存到文件”,并选择保存格式为Excel文件或CSV文件。

2. Directory List & Print

Directory List & Print是一款专门用于生成目录列表的工具,支持多种输出格式,包括Excel格式。

步骤:

  1. 下载并安装Directory List & Print。
  2. 打开软件并选择目标目录。
  3. 选择“文件夹”选项卡,勾选“显示文件夹名称”。
  4. 点击“导出”按钮,并选择保存格式为Excel文件。

三、手动复制粘贴

如果文件夹数量不多,还可以通过手动复制粘贴的方法来实现。具体步骤如下:

  1. 打开目标目录并将文件夹名称显示出来。
  2. 选择所有文件夹名称并复制(可以使用快捷键Ctrl+ACtrl+C)。
  3. 打开Excel文件并将复制的内容粘贴进去(使用快捷键Ctrl+V)。

四、总结

将文件夹名称转为Excel列表的方法有很多,最为推荐的是使用Python脚本,因为它可以处理大量文件夹名称,并且具有很高的灵活性和可扩展性。对于不熟悉编程的用户,可以选择使用文件管理软件,如Total Commander或Directory List & Print,这些工具同样可以高效地完成任务。最后,对于文件夹数量较少的情况,手动复制粘贴也是一种简单可行的方法。

相关问答FAQs:

1. 如何将文件夹名称转换为Excel列表?

  • Q: 如何将文件夹名称导入到Excel中?
    • A: 可以使用VBA宏或者Power Query来实现将文件夹名称导入到Excel中。使用VBA宏需要编写一段代码来遍历文件夹并将名称逐一添加到Excel表格中;而使用Power Query则可以直接连接到文件夹,并将文件夹中的文件名提取到Excel表格中。

2. 怎样将文件夹名称导入到Excel表格中?

  • Q: 是否有一种简单的方法将文件夹中的文件名导入到Excel表格中?
    • A: 是的,您可以使用Power Query来轻松导入文件夹名称到Excel表格中。在Excel中,选择“数据”选项卡,然后点击“来自文件”->“来自文件夹”。选择要导入的文件夹,Power Query会自动将文件夹中的文件名提取到Excel表格中。

3. 如何将文件夹名称转换为Excel列表并添加其他属性?

  • Q: 我想将文件夹名称转换为Excel列表,并在每个文件夹名称后面添加其他属性,有什么方法可以实现吗?
    • A: 您可以使用VBA宏来实现将文件夹名称转换为Excel列表并添加其他属性。编写一段VBA代码,遍历文件夹并将文件夹名称逐一添加到Excel表格中。在添加文件夹名称时,您可以根据需要添加其他属性,例如文件夹路径、创建日期等。通过编写适当的代码,您可以根据文件夹名称添加其他属性,以创建一个丰富多彩的Excel列表。

文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4718133

(0)
Edit1Edit1
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部